1. Unraveling the Mystery: Medicare Part B and Drugs!

Medicare Part B primarily provides coverage for outpatient care, medical services, and preventive care. However, the mystery surrounding its drug coverage can leave many scratching their heads. Unlike Medicare Part D, which is specifically designed for comprehensive prescription drug coverage, Part B has a more limited scope when it comes to medications. So, what’s the scoop? Well, Part B does cover certain types of outpatient medications that are typically administered in a clinical setting.

These medications include drugs that are deemed necessary for the treatment of specific medical conditions, especially those administered via injection or infusion. For instance, some cancer medications and drugs for chronic conditions like rheumatoid arthritis may qualify for coverage under Part B. It’s crucial to know that medications taken at home or those filled at a pharmacy usually fall under Part D. So while Part B might not be your go-to for all prescription needs, it does provide coverage for some essential treatments!

4. Medicare’s Little Secrets: Drug Coverage Revealed!

Shh! We’re about to let you in on some of Medicare’s little secrets regarding Part B drug coverage! Did you know that certain drugs used in outpatient procedures are also covered? For instance, if you’re receiving chemotherapy or specific infusions, the medications used during these procedures could be covered under Part B. It’s all about where and how you receive the medication!

Another little secret is that some durable medical equipment (DME) items may have drugs associated with them that are covered under Part B. For example, inhalation drugs administered through nebulizers qualify for coverage if they are prescribed as part of your treatment plan. These hidden gems of coverage can make a big difference in your treatment and overall healthcare experience!
